Output 53f3f3be3a167ac6c357bf34c4e53e4f0d3522b31347ba3542d1a67f4a511e4f:5

value
155425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084a24edb224856439492c5532d630469e469746 OP_EQUAL
address
32Sr9iDC2YcDtKq4tAivQ9XVxD3YmAwyqA
transaction
53f3f3be3a167ac6c357bf34c4e53e4f0d3522b31347ba3542d1a67f4a511e4f
confirmations
118045
spent
true